Reland after https://reviews.llvm.org/D66806 fixed the false-positive diagnostics. Summary: This fixes inference of gsl::Pointer on std::set::iterator with libstdc++ (the typedef for iterator on the template is a DependentNameType - we can only put the gsl::Pointer attribute on the underlaying record after instantiation) inference of gsl::Pointer on std::vector::iterator with libc++ (the class was forward-declared, we added the gsl::Pointer on the canonical decl (the forward decl), and later when the template was instantiated, there was no attribute on the definition so it was not instantiated). and a duplicate gsl::Pointer on some class with libstdc++ (we first added an attribute to a incomplete instantiation, and then another was copied from the template definition when the instantiation was completed). We now add the attributes to all redeclarations to fix thos issues and make their usage easier.
